"The location is right near the Cipanas Tarogong Kaler intersection, next to Indomaret. It's easy to find. Even though it's in the middle of town, there's minimal traffic noise. The hotel is comfortable, with a unique concept, like a cluster complex with a carport next to it. Inside, there's a stove and simple cooking utensils, all neatly arranged in the kitchen. The staff is responsive and easy to ask for help. If you get bored in your room, you can walk out the back to find a mini aviary, playground, shooting range, and a relaxing area. Amenities are basic: Wi-Fi works, the toilet works, but the water heater only works at night. It doesn't work in the morning, although the water isn't too cold. Breakfast is yellow rice with fried chicken, fried noodles, and bottled juice. Overall, I'm satisfied with the hotel and its unique concept, a complex with touches of military ornamentation here and there."

AAnonymous UserThe place has a super location. It’s near the city, but actually located in the hot Springs area. We love the landscape and the view. There are a lot of activities that we can do in the hotel, like horse riding, feeding the animals, canoeing, flying fox, swimming, even fishing. The cleanliness of the rooms are not so good. Maybe it was not easy to maintain such big place. My kids love the activities offered there. For me it is a little bit too bustling, especially in the swimming pool area. Because there are a lot of people who weren’t staying in the hotel that could buy a ticket to swim there, so the swimming pool area is not very comfortable to swim in. People are buying a lot of instant noodles and coffees, and they just throw the garbage everywhere. There are cigarette butts, cups, and noodle bows littered absolutely everywhere. I think they should limit how many outsiders could buy a ticket to swim so the area will be still comfortable for the hotel guests, and hire more people to clean. The food was horrible, especially for breakfast, it was almost inedible.
